British explorer Sir Ernest Shackleton led the ill-fated Endurance Expedition to the South Pole in 1914.

This 1999 Minnesota Public Radio documentary by John Rabe details the heroic expedition. "Walking Out of History" tells the adventures of Shackleton and his crew during the two-year voyage.
